4 // -----------------------------------------------------
7 // -----------------------------------------------------
9 @import url('https://fonts.googleapis.com/css?family=Droid+Sans:400,700');
16 .navbar .nav-collapse.in .nav li > a {
22 label, input, button, select, textarea,
23 .navbar .search-query:-moz-placeholder,
24 .navbar .search-query::-webkit-input-placeholder {
25 font-family: 'Droid Sans', sans-serif;
30 font-weight: normal !important;
34 border-left: 5px solid @blue;
37 border-right: 5px solid @blue;
42 // -----------------------------------------------------
45 #gradient > .vertical (@bodyBackground, #252A30);
49 border-bottom: 2px solid @blue
53 // -----------------------------------------------------
59 border-bottom: 2px solid @blue
63 padding: 12px 20px 8px;
67 padding: 13px 10px 8px;
68 border-bottom: 3px solid rgba(0, 0, 0, 0);
71 .navbar .nav .active > a,
72 .navbar .nav li > a:hover,
73 .navbar .brand:hover {
74 border-bottom: 3px solid @blue
77 .navbar .search-query,
78 .navbar .search-query:focus,
79 .navbar .search-query.focused {
82 background-color: #222;
87 .navbar .nav > li > a {
88 border-left: 1px solid #222;
92 background-color: #191A1A;
93 border-left: solid 1px rgba(255, 255, 255, 0.1);
94 .box-shadow(0 2px 4px rgba(0, 0, 0, 0.8));
97 .dropdown-menu li > a:hover {
98 background-color: @blue;
99 border-bottom: 3px solid transparent;
102 .dropdown-menu .divider {
103 background-color: #222;
104 border-bottom: 0px solid white;
107 .navbar .dropdown-menu::before,
108 .navbar .dropdown-menu::after {
112 .navbar .nav-collapse.in .nav > li > a {
116 .navbar .nav-collapse.in .nav a:hover {
117 background-color: @blue;
122 background-color: @grayDarker;
123 background-image: none;
127 div.subnav.subnav-fixed {
133 div.subnav .nav > li > a,
134 div.subnav .nav .active a {
135 background-color: @grayDarker;
136 border-left: 1px solid #222;
141 div.subnav .nav li.nav-header {
145 .subnav .nav > li > a:hover,
146 .subnav .nav > li.active > a:hover,
147 .subnav .nav > li:first-child > a:hover {
148 background: transparent;
149 border-bottom: 2px solid @blue;
150 border-left: 1px solid #222;
154 div.subnav .nav .dropdown.open {
158 border-left: 1px solid #222;
159 border-bottom: 2px solid @blue;
160 background-color: #060606;
164 background-color: @grayDarker;
165 border-left: solid 1px rgba(255, 255, 255, 0.1);
174 @media (max-width: 768px) {
175 div.subnav .nav > li + li > a,
176 div.subnav .nav > li:first-child > a {
177 border-top: 1px solid #222;
178 border-left: 1px solid #222;
181 .subnav .nav > li + li > a:hover,
182 .subnav .nav > li:first-child > a:hover {
184 background-color: @blue;
189 // -----------------------------------------------------
191 .nav-list > li > a, .nav-list .nav-header {
195 .nav-list li > a:hover,
196 .nav-tabs li > a:hover,
197 .nav-tabs li.active > a,
198 .nav-pills li > a:hover,
199 .nav-stacked li > a:hover,
200 .nav-stacked li.active > a {
201 background-color: @blue;
206 border-bottom: 1px solid #222;
209 .nav-stacked > li > a,
210 .nav-tabs > li > a:hover,
211 .nav-tabs > .active > a,
212 .nav-tabs > .active > a:hover {
213 border: 1px solid #222 !important;
216 .nav.nav-tabs .active a:hover {
217 background-color: @blue;
221 .nav.nav-tabs .dropdown.open,
222 .nav.nav-pills .dropdown.open {
224 background-color: #060606 !important;
226 border: 1px solid #222;
229 .dropdown-menu li > a:hover { border-bottom: 0; }
232 .tabbable .nav-tabs, .thumbnail {
237 background-color: transparent;
238 background-image: none;
264 background-color: @blue;
270 // -----------------------------------------------------
274 .box-shadow(1px 1px 2px #111);
275 .buttonBackground(darken(@gray, 20%), darken(@gray, 30%));
286 .buttonBackground(@blueDark, darken(@blueDark, 10%));
290 .buttonBackground(lighten(@orange, 10%), @orange);
294 .buttonBackground(lighten(@red, 10%), @red);
298 .buttonBackground(lighten(@green, 10%), @green);
302 .buttonBackground(darken(@gray, 40%), darken(@gray, 50%));
306 .buttonBackground(lighten(@purple, 5%), @purple);
309 .btn-group .btn:first-child {
310 -webkit-border-top-left-radius: 3px;
311 -moz-border-top-left-radius: 3px;
312 border-top-left-radius: 3px;
314 -webkit-border-bottom-left-radius: 3px;
315 -moz-border-bottom-left-radius: 3px;
316 border-bottom-left-radius: 3px;
319 .btn-group .btn:last-child, .btn-group .dropdown-toggle {
320 -webkit-border-top-right-radius: 3px;
321 -moz-border-top-right-radius: 3px;
322 border-top-right-radius: 3px;
324 -webkit-border-bottom-right-radius: 3px;
325 -moz-border-bottom-right-radius: 3px;
326 border-bottom-right-radius: 3px;
331 border-top: 4px solid black;
335 .btn-group > .dropdown-menu > li > a:hover {
339 .btn.disabled, .btn[disabled] {
340 background-color: @grayLight;
344 // -----------------------------------------------------
346 input, textarea, select {
352 border-bottom: 0px solid #222;
355 input, textarea, select, .uneditable-input {
359 input[disabled], select[disabled], textarea[disabled], input[readonly], select[readonly], textarea[readonly], .uneditable-input {
360 background-color: #555;
368 border-color: rgba(82,168,236,1);
370 outline: thin dotted \9; /* IE6-9 */
373 input[type="file"]:focus,
374 input[type="radio"]:focus,
375 input[type="checkbox"]:focus,
377 .box-shadow(none); // override for file inputs
382 background: transparent;
385 .form-actions, footer.footer {
386 border-top: 1px solid #222;
390 // -----------------------------------------------------
394 border-top: solid 1px rgba(255, 255, 255, 0.3);
395 background-color: @grayDark;
399 border-bottom: 1px solid #222;
403 background-color: @grayDark;
404 border-top: 1px solid #222;
405 .border-radius(0 0 6px 6px);
410 // -----------------------------------------------------
412 .table, .well, .hero-unit, .prettyprint, input, textarea, select {
416 code, pre, pre.prettyprint {
417 background-color: @grayLighter;
421 background-color: #131517;
422 border-top: solid 1px rgba(255, 255, 255, 0.1);
423 .box-shadow(0 2px 4px rgba(0,0,0,.8));
427 background-color: #060606;
428 background-image: none;
436 .label, .alert { background-color: darken(@gray, 20%); }
438 .label:hover { background-color: darken(@gray, 30%); }
441 .label-important, .alert-danger,
442 .alert-error { background-color: @red; }
444 .label-important:hover { background-color: darken(@red, 10%); }
446 .label-warning { background-color: darken(@orange, 10%); }
448 .label-warning:hover { background-color: darken(@orange, 20%); }
450 .label-success, .alert-success { background-color: darken(@green, 3%); }
452 .label-success:hover { background-color: darken(@green, 13%); }
454 .label-info, .alert-info { background-color: darken(@blueDark, 10%); }
456 .label-info:hover { background-color: darken(@blueDark, 20%); }
459 .alert .alert-heading,
461 .alert-success .alert-heading,
464 .alert-danger .alert-heading,
465 .alert-error .alert-heading,
467 .alert-info .alert-heading {